Poster presentation - a visual medium for academic and scientific meetings

Summary
Academic posters are a visual publication medium for health professionals, but have limitations in knowledge transfer. Their effectiveness is enhanced through author presentations or multimedia resources.
Area of Science:
- Health Professions Education
- Scientific Communication
Background:
- Academic posters are a common medium for knowledge transfer and publication among health professionals.
- The visual format aims to attract attention and convey messages effectively.
- Limitations exist regarding depth of information, production, and viewer comprehension.
Purpose of the Study:
- To provide an overview of the current concept and practicality of academic poster publications.
- To outline principles of poster compilation and presentation for academic and scientific meetings.
Main Methods:
- Literature review on academic poster presentations.
- Analysis of the strengths and limitations of the poster medium.
- Examples of effective poster compilation and presentation strategies.
Main Results:
- Posters are widely adopted but have inherent limitations as a standalone medium for in-depth information transfer.
- Effectiveness is significantly improved when posters are supported by live author presentations or digital resources.
- Practical guidance on poster design and delivery is crucial for maximizing impact.
Conclusions:
- Academic posters remain a valuable tool in scientific and academic communities, especially in health professions.
- The utility of posters is contingent on addressing their limitations through supplementary presentation methods.
- Effective poster design and delivery are key to successful knowledge transfer in academic settings.

Vision
Vision is the result of light being detected and transduced into neural signals by the retina of the eye. This information is then further analyzed and interpreted by the brain. First, light enters the front of the eye and is focused by the cornea and lens onto the retina—a thin sheet of neural tissue lining the back of the eye. Because of refraction through the convex lens of the eye, images are projected onto the retina upside-down and reversed.
